+# Channels
+
+Limbo supports concurrent communication and synchronization between processes via channels and a few structures working in tandem with channels.
+
+The design for channels is inspired primarily by "Communicating Sequential Processes" (CSP) by Tony Hoare.
+
+Further reading on CSP: http://www.usingcsp.com/cspbook.pdf
